Hammond Manufacturing Company Limited (TSX: HMM.A) announced record revenue and earnings for the second quarter ending June 26, 2026, underscoring robust demand across North American markets and a temporary reduction in US tariff-related costs. The company's performance highlights its ability to navigate the evolving US trade environment, which continues to present challenges but also opportunities for strategic positioning.
In its financial results released July 28, 2026, Hammond Manufacturing reported that its proactive strategy to protect and strengthen US business has enhanced its competitive position. The company expressed confidence in its ability to respond effectively to changing market conditions, even as uncertainties persist in 2026. The record results reflect the strength of the company's operations and its focus on customer service.
Hammond Manufacturing is actively expanding its manufacturing capabilities to support growth. An 85,000 square foot facility expansion, announced on March 13, 2026, is underway, along with additional paint and metal fabrication capacity at all sites. These investments are designed to meet increasing demand and reinforce the company's commitment to serving the electronic and electrical products industry.

Hammond Manufacturing produces a broad range of products, including metallic and non-metallic enclosures, racks, small cases, outlet strips, surge suppressors, and electronic transformers.
